Small Wall Mirror
The small mirror above the kitchen sink was a last minute addition to the camper kitchen. I realized that I needed something there so I could see myself when I washed my face, put in my contacts, etc. My parents had this mirror in a random box in their condo going unused. The timing of finding it and needing it were just aligned in a way that was serendipitous. I placed two zelcro-style Command Strips on the back of the mirror, so I can take it off the wall when the camper is being towed.
I am also quite lucky that my short stature worked in my favor for this solution. If I was any taller than my 5’2 height, I would not have found this to work as well. So, fair warning: tall folks, or even average height folks, probably won’t find this helpful.
